Data Center Tool Highlights:
– This version adds a new firmware update for the Intel SSD DC S3710, DC S3610, DC S3510, DC S3500 M.2 and DC S3500 HD Series. For all above listed products, the latest firmware revision is G2010140.
Intel Solid-State Drive DC S3710, DC S3610 and DC S3510 Series Revision G2010140:
This firmware revision has several continuous improvement optimizations intended to provide the best possible user experience with the Intel SSD.
The following issues are also fixed in this release:
– Added support for SMART Attribute F3h
– Modification to Secure Erase to include NAND Erase
– Improvements to the Maximum Latency for all Sequential and Random Write workloads
– Added a fourth PHY mode setting to accommodate long interconnects (> 8-inches)

The Intel SSD Data Center Tool supports the following Intel SSDs:
– Intel SSD 750 Series
– Intel SSD DC P3500 Series
– Intel SSD DC P3600 Series
– Intel SSD DC P3700 Series
– Intel SSD DC S3500 Series
– Intel SSD DC S3510 Series
– Intel SSD DC S3610 Series
– Intel SSD DC S3700 Series
– Intel SSD DC S3710 Series
HELPFUL NOTES:
– The Intel SSD Data Center Tool incorporates a help screen providing additional information for each command.
– Use of the tool under Windows operating systems requires administrator access by right clicking on the Command Prompt icon and selecting “Run as Administrator”.
